How much air space should be provided between batteries?
When connecting the batteries, free air space must be provided between each battery. The recommended minimum spacing between batteries is 0.2 inches (5mm) to 0.4 inches (10mm). In all installations, consideration must be given to adequate ventilation for the purposes of cooling.

Can a battery be operated in a confined space?
When the battery is operated in a confined space, adequate ventilation should be provided. The battery case is manufactured from high impact ABS plastic resin. It should not be placed in an atmosphere of, or in contact with organic solvents or adhesive materials. Correct terminals should be used on battery connecting wires.
